      What is the primary purpose of implementing a 3-2-1

      backup strategy?
      A To reduce data storage costs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      B To ensure high availability of applications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      C To protect against data loss by having multiple backup copies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      D To simplify data recovery processes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      E To enable faster data processing speeds Correct Answer Incorrect Answer

      Solution

      The 3-2-1 backup strategy is a widely recognized best practice in data protection that states you should maintain three total copies of your data, two of which are stored on different devices or media, and one of which is stored offsite. This strategy is designed to minimize the risk of data loss from hardware failures, accidental deletions, or disasters like fires or floods. By having multiple copies, it ensures that even if one backup fails or becomes corrupted, the data can still be recovered from other sources. The offsite component further protects data from localized threats, ensuring greater resilience and security for vital information. Why Other Options are Wrong: A) While the 3-2-1 strategy can lead to optimized storage costs over time, its primary focus is not cost reduction but rather data safety. B) High availability is generally addressed through redundancy and clustering solutions, rather than solely through backup strategies. D) Simplifying data recovery is a benefit but not the primary objective; the main aim is to ensure that data can be reliably restored from various sources. E) Backup strategies do not directly influence data processing speeds; they are primarily focused on data integrity and recoverability.
